public static final class GetScalingRulesResponseBody.Data.Builder extends Object
构造器和说明 |
---|
Builder() |
限定符和类型 | 方法和说明 |
---|---|
GetScalingRulesResponseBody.Data |
build() |
GetScalingRulesResponseBody.Data.Builder |
clusterType(Integer clusterType)
The type of the cluster.
|
GetScalingRulesResponseBody.Data.Builder |
oversoldFactor(Integer oversoldFactor)
The overcommit ratio supported by a Docker cluster.
|
GetScalingRulesResponseBody.Data.Builder |
ruleList(GetScalingRulesResponseBody.RuleList ruleList)
The array data of the scaling rule.
|
GetScalingRulesResponseBody.Data.Builder |
updateTime(Long updateTime)
The time when the scaling rule was last updated.
|
GetScalingRulesResponseBody.Data.Builder |
vpcId(String vpcId)
The ID of the virtual private cloud (VPC).
|
public GetScalingRulesResponseBody.Data.Builder clusterType(Integer clusterType)
* 0: regular Docker cluster * 1: Swarm cluster (deprecated) * 2: Elastic Compute Service (ECS) cluster * 3: self-managed Kubernetes cluster in EDAS * 4: cluster in which Pandora automatically registers applications * 5: Container Service for Kubernetes (ACK) clusters
public GetScalingRulesResponseBody.Data.Builder oversoldFactor(Integer oversoldFactor)
* 1: 1:1, which means that resources are not overcommitted. * 2: 1:2, which means that resources are overcommitted by 1:2. * 4: 1:4, which means that resources are overcommitted by 1:4. * 8: 1:8, which means that resources are overcommitted by 1:8.
public GetScalingRulesResponseBody.Data.Builder ruleList(GetScalingRulesResponseBody.RuleList ruleList)
public GetScalingRulesResponseBody.Data.Builder updateTime(Long updateTime)
public GetScalingRulesResponseBody.Data.Builder vpcId(String vpcId)
public GetScalingRulesResponseBody.Data build()
Copyright © 2023. All rights reserved.